A Reputable Platform with Strong Regulation

Your money's safety should be paramount, and Plus500 ensures this with top-tier regulation. Authorised by the FCA, one of the financial industry's most reputable bodies, Plus500 operates under strict guidelines. Your funds are kept in segregated bank accounts, and Plus500 doesn't use client money for speculative positions. This makes Plus500 a secure choice, especially for those just starting out.

Competitive and Transparent Fees

Worried about hidden charges? Plus500's fee structure is clear and competitive. Most services are free, with the platform making its money from the bid/ask spreads. Plus500 covers most payment processing fees, meaning no additional charges for deposits and withdrawals.

However, it's important to note that some specific fees may apply in rare cases, such as:

  • Overnight Funding: Holding positions beyond the designated time may lead to a fee.

  • Currency Conversion Fee: If trading in a different currency than your account, a conversion fee may apply.

  • Inactivity Fee: No login activity for at least three months might result in a monthly charge.

Trading Strategies and Risk Management

Though scalping and hedging strategies are not permitted on Plus500, the platform provides valuable risk management tools, such as 'Close at Profit' and 'Close at Loss' rates, Guaranteed Stop and Trailing Stop orders. These features can be particularly helpful to new traders, helping you control your exposure to risk.

 

Pros of Trading with Plus500

  1. Established Reputation: Founded in 2008, Plus500 is publicly traded (LSE: PLUS) and part of the FTSE 250 Index, highlighting its credibility and status in the industry.

  2. Robust Regulation: Plus500 is regulated in six Tier-1 jurisdictions, three Tier-2 jurisdictions, and one Tier-4 jurisdiction, assuring traders of its adherence to stringent regulatory standards.

  3. Beginner-Friendly Platform: Plus500's web-based trading platform is user-friendly and recommended for beginner traders, offering an accessible entry point into trading.

  4. Advanced Analytics Tools: The new +Insights analytics tool includes integration of advanced sentiment features from Trading Central and FactSet, providing traders with deep insights.

  5. Cross-Device Compatibility: Plus500’s web platform and mobile app deliver robust charting with a consistent experience across devices, ensuring seamless trading.

  6. Wide Range of Symbols: Offering a good range of 2,800 tradable symbols as CFDs, Plus500 caters to a diverse trading interest.

  7. Competitive Spreads: Plus500 appears to offer spreads close to the industry average on most major forex pairs, allowing traders competitive entry and exit points.

  8. CFD Option Availability: Traders have the opportunity to explore CFD option contracts available on 24 popular symbols.

Cons of Trading with Plus500

  1. Limited Attractiveness for Active Traders: The Plus500 platform may seem basic to active traders looking for more comprehensive features.

  2. Lack of Educational Content: Plus500 does not offer an extensive variety of educational content, which could hinder learning opportunities for newcomers to financial markets.

  3. Absence of News Headlines: Despite its integrated economic calendar, news headlines are missing from the Plus500 platform suite, potentially limiting context for trading decisions.

  4. Limited Research Content: Plus500’s research content includes only a few daily articles, and its video content lacks regular market updates or analysis, possibly reducing the depth of market understanding.
